Well - I think I just jinxed myself in the other .5 thread. I said how cool everything was running and I would try gearing up. I did and I think I overdid it. I went up a tooth on the pinion to 13t (with the 46t kyosho spur) and put a 3S cell in which is the configuration that I ran the speed runs with. No problems with heat on the short speed bursts. However, this is not a good combination at the track. ESC did shut down on me after about 5 minutes of run time and motor was close to 200 :026:. I would like to keep the 3S and perhaps drop the gearing back down. I didn't have any other pinions with me at the time so I'll have to try again another day.

project update
It's been nice reading everyone else's input to their .5 builds. The motor and gearing issues of particular issues. I've been running 12t/46t with the 4600 on 3S and it does tend to get on the warm side in the 160-170 range after 15 min or so on the track. Then again my shell is closed with no air flowing through so that could be a big contributor to that. We'll see as I will head to the track today with the new 2.2 Snake Eyes truck tires installed. I've also put a heat sink on the motor. The RPM receiver box is a new addition that now safely houses my rx and UBEC.

The RPM box and ESC are servo taped to an aluminum top plate that replaced the stock top plate. Nothing fancy going on there.
Well, here is the report on the 2.2 Proline Snake Eyes. Go out and get them. If your track is at all like mine with big ruts and lots of bumps and imperfections then the truck tires are the way to go. It was soaking up stuff that flipped it over before with the buggy sized tires. And I really don't think I lost much at all in terms of handling. What was lost there was more than made up by greater stability on the bumpy straights. Here's the skinny: Pro-Line Snake Eyes 2.2 M3 Associated GT2 Rear Wheels #7847 Traxxas Axle Pins #2754 The stock axle pins were a couple mm too long to fit the AE wheels. I used the AE wheels because I found the ribbing in the Pro-Line wheels that I tried rubbed the uprights. Here's the video. |
